Holidays Trips

mercredi 25 février 2015

Falls of Glomach

One of the highest waterfalls in Britain set in narrow cleft in the remote countryside above Morvich. To reach the falls requires a 10-11 mile walk taking 5 hours.

Source: Britain Express – Attractions


    



Falls of Glomach

Aucun commentaire:

Enregistrer un commentaire